What is a Small Cot Bed?
To comprehend the appeal, it helps to take a look at meanings.
- Standard Crib: Typically determines around 120cm x 60cm and is designed for babies approximately about 18 to 24 months. As soon as the child outgrows it, parents must buy a new young child bed.
- Requirement Cot Bed: Usually measures 140cm x 70cm and converts into a toddler bed, lasting as much as age four or 5. Nevertheless, these can dominate a little room.
- Small Cot Bed: Typically measures around 120cm x 60cm (the size of a basic crib) however includes the convertible style of a cot bed. It bridges the gap by using durability in a compact footprint.
Why Choose a Small Cot Bed? Key Benefits
For numerous households, standard furnishings is just too bulky. Here is why a compact or little cot bed is quickly ending up being a nursery staple:
- Maximized Floor Space: Ideal for smaller bedrooms, nurseries in city apartments, or perhaps for establishing a sleeping location in the primary bedroom.
- Cost-Effectiveness: Because it converts from a cot to a young child bed, moms and dads don’t require to purchase a different transitional bed as the child grows.
- Cozy Environment: Newborns typically feel overwhelmed in huge open areas. The smaller footprint of a compact cot simulates the secure feeling of the womb, helping babies settle more quickly.
- Easier Mobility: Many small cot beds are lightweight and featured optional caster wheels, making it simpler to reposition them for cleaning up or space layouts.

Secret Features to Look For When Buying
When looking for a little cot bed, parents need to examine numerous vital elements to ensure security, durability, and convenience:
- Adjustable Base Heights: Look for a cot with multiple bed mattress base levels. A high setting makes it easy to lift a newborn without straining the back, while the lowest setting avoids daring toddlers from climbing up out.
- Teething Rails: Plastic or smooth wooden guards along the top edges secure the wood from teething gums and secure the baby from ingesting paint or wood splinters.
- Safety Certifications: Ensure the cot abides by security requirements (such as EN 716 in Europe or ASTM F1169 in the US). Slats should be spaced no greater than 6.5 cm apart to prevent a baby’s head from getting stuck.
- Product Quality: Solid wood (like pine, beech, or birch) offers resilience, while crafted wood or MDF can provide a budget-friendly, lightweight alternative.
Tips for Maximizing Space Around a Small Cot Bed
Acquiring a little cot bed is simply the initial step in optimizing a compact nursery. To take advantage of the offered square footage, think about the following methods:
- Utilize Under-Bed Storage: Many little cot beds feature incorporated drawers beneath. If yours does not, use low-profile storage bins to slide below for diapers, extra sheets, or out-of-season clothes.
- Go Vertical: Floor area is valuable, so make use of the walls. Set up drifting racks for books, wall-mounted baskets for toys, and a hanging organizer for everyday essentials rather of a bulky altering table.
- Select Multi-Functional Furniture: Opt for an altering top that fits safely straight over the top of the small cot bed rather than acquiring a separate changing station.
- Keep Decor Minimalist: Embrace a Scandinavian or minimalist aesthetic. Fewer items in the room produce a calmer sleep environment for the baby and a less chaotic feel for parents.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How long can a child use a little cot bed?
Due to its convertible nature, a little cot bed (normally 120cm x 60cm) can usually be used from birth up until the kid is around 3 to 4 years old, depending on the child’s height and growth rate.
2. Can I utilize standard bed linen with a small cot bed?
It depends on the specific dimensions of the bed. If the bed mattress is 120cm x 60cm (which is the basic UK/European cot size), then standard cot sheets, blankets, and bed mattress will fit completely. Constantly determine the bed mattress measurements before buying linens.
3. Are small cot beds safe for newborns?
Yes, absolutely. As long as the cot satisfies existing security regulations, has company and appropriately fitted bed mattress, and adheres to safe sleep standards (no loose blankets, pillows, or bumpers), a small cot bed is entirely safe for babies.
4. Is it hard to transform a little cot bed into a young child bed?
Most contemporary little cot beds are developed with ease of usage in mind. Transforming them usually involves getting rid of one side rail and attaching a half-guard rail (frequently included or offered independently) using basic family tools like an Allen wrench. The procedure generally takes less than 30 minutes.
